LIEBERT, Georges. Nietzsche and Music. Translated by David Pellauer and Graham Parkes. Chicago: University of Chicago Press, 2004. x + 291. Cloth, $38.00--The title of this translation of Nietzsche et la musique (Paris, 1995) is slightly misleading; more apt would be something like "Nietzsche and the Composers". Chapter Three, for example, points to Nietzsche's "affinities with Schumann", and the central five chapters tell the history of Nietzsche's turbulent relationship with Richard Wagner and his music.
